Abstract

The invention relates to a cooling fin convenient to install. The cooling fin convenient to install comprises a cooling fin body provided with at least three fin bodies on one side. The gap reserved between every two adjacent fin bodies is wide at the two ends and narrow in the middle. A protruding clamping block is arranged on the other side of the cooling fin body. The cooling fin convenient to install is simple in structure and convenient and fast to install, and saves the manufacturing cost.

Background technology
Fin is a kind of device to the easy heat-generating electronic elements heat radiation in electrical equipment, because it has increased surface area, so accelerated the speed of absorption and dissipated heat, by the heat transmission, plays the effect of quick heat radiating.
Fin on existing fin is arranged comparatively tight, fin can be installed on machine or equipment for considering, need on fin, design some supplementary structures, as set up mount pad etc., thus, increased manufacturing cost, in addition, the limited space of fin is installed on machine or equipment, as need, set up mount pad, reduced the space of fin, for adapting to space size, can only dwindle the volume of fin, thus the effect of impact heat radiation.

Embodiment
The present invention is further detailed explanation in conjunction with the accompanying drawings and embodiments now, and these accompanying drawings are the schematic diagram of simplification, basic structure of the present invention only is described in a schematic way, so it only shows the formation relevant with the present invention.
As shown in Figures 1 to 4, a kind of fin easy for installation, comprise that a side is provided with the heat sink body 10 of at least three fins 20, the 30 wide centres, two ends, space that form between two adjacent fins 20 are narrow, heat sink body 10 opposite sides are provided with protruding fixture block 40, the thickness of heat sink body 10 is less than the thickness of fixture block 40, on heat sink body 10 two ends, 30 two ends are provided with fixing hole 50 over against space, heat sink body 10 two ends are provided with groove 60 between two fixing holes 50, fixture block 40 is between two grooves 60.
Fin of the present invention when mounted, only need snap onto fixture block 40 in draw-in groove reserved on machine or equipment, and by screw, penetrating fixing hole 50 can lock this fin on machine or equipment, convenient and swift.
The invention has the beneficial effects as follows:
1, make the 30 wide centres, two ends, space that form between two adjacent fins 20 on heat sink body 10 narrow, be convenient in 30 places, wider space, offer fixing hole on heat sink body 10, and mount pad is not set in addition, saved cost.
2, at heat sink body 10 opposite sides, protruding fixture block 40 is set, easy for installation; The thickness of fixture block 40 is greater than the thickness of heat sink body, can make fixture block 40 snap in the degree of depth of draw-in groove darker, prevents because of the more shallow landing of the degree of depth snapped in.
3, groove 60 is set on the two ends of heat sink body 10, personnel easy to use are affectedly bashful.
